2018 CEPCI Updates: April (prelim.) and March (final)

| By Scott Jenkins

The preliminary value for the April 2018 CE Plant Cost Index (CEPCI; most recent available) jumped  compared to the previous month’s value, continuing a string of monthly increases since the beginning of the year. And for the third consecutive month, all four of the subindices (Equipment, Buildings, Construction Labor and Engineering & Supervision) moved higher for April. The Equipment subindex had the largest month-to-month increase, percentage-wise. The overal CEPCI for March stands at 5.1% higher than the corresponding value from April of last year. Meanwhile, the Current Business Indicators (CBI) showed a small decrease in the CPI output index for May 2018.
